Cricket
Dubai: The International Cricket Council (ICC) on Thursday announced the names of umpires and referees to officiate in the Asia Cup from June 24 in Pakistan. Mike Procter of the Emirates Elite Panel of ICC Match Referees will oversee the matches staged in Lahore, while Alan Hurst, also of the Elite Panel, will supervise the matches to be played in Karachi. The ICC-appointed on-field umpires will be Simon Taufel and Brian Jerling of Elite Panel, and Ian Gould and Tony Hill of the Emirates International Panel of ICC Umpires. Appointments for the second round matches will be announced in due course. Asia Cup Match Referees: Mike Procter (Lahore), Alan Hurst (Karachi); June 24: Bangladesh vs. UAE (Lahore) Simon Taufel, Ian Gould; Pakistan vs. Hong Kong (Karachi) Tony Hill, Brian Jerling. June 25: Bangladesh vs. Sri Lanka (Lahore) Taufel, Gould; India vs. Hong Kong (Karachi) Hill, Jerling. June 26: Sri Lanka vs. UAE (Lahore) Taufel, Gould; Pakistan vs. India (Karachi) Hill, Jerling. — PTI
